The Athlon X2 3800+ is what I bought for about the same price as aP4/3ghz. Benchmarks I have seen with multithreaded apps (insert Maxwell, Lightwave, Max, etc) are TWICE AS FAST as the P4... or thereabouts..
in effect you get much more rendering power for the money. Keep in mind though, due to NL's somewhat backwards licensing policy you are using TWO CPUs with an X2 not one like with the P4. You would get more punch with two P4 machines... but not by a whole lot, plus the X2 generates about the same amount of heat as a standard Athlon and sucks about the same amount of power.
IMHO the dualcore athlons are the best bang for the $ out there, much faster then the dual core P4s. I'm seeing render benchmarks with LW and Max with a 3800 only slightly slower then a dual Xeon setup... which aside from really peeving the guy who spent $10,000 on his system means... well.. it's a damn fast... where a P4 is great for Apps which are NOT multithreaded, like iTunes and MS word... the Athlon X2s are the perfect choice for software capable of utilizing dual core CPUs... like maxwell!
